Demo #1 is almost ready. However, because it is a very bare bone demo I feel it would be best to talk about what to expect and give some instructions on how to play.
The controls are as follows:
WASD - move
Mouse - look around
Mouse_Left - Attack
Mouse_Right - Block
Shift - drop block/run
Esc - Close game menu/pause/unlock mouse
In addition, there are 3 "cheats":
T - revives the player and teleport her to the starting position (if got stuck/fell through map)
K - kills the enemy the crosshair is pointing at
L - spawn more enemies
In demo1, there is a medium sized enclosed area with some enemies scattered about. They don't aggro you until you walk close to them. This is so that it's up to the player on how many enemies to engage at once. Press L if you feel the enemy density is too low.
The most important thing regarding combat is that block only works if you block the correct direction of the incoming attack. So if an attack comes from the left, then you need to do a left block.
The direction of block is determined via mouse movement. If you swipe the mouse left, then a left block will be activated when the block key is pressed. If you swipe right, then she will do a right block, and so on. There is an indicator on block direction on the crosshair as well.
Many enemies can block as well. So if an enemy is blocking left, left attacks are ineffective. Attack direction comes from the same direction as the block. So to do a left attack, first block left and then hold and release the attack key.
Many things are still missing/todo, including but not limited to things like sound, outfit damage, and so on.
My focus for demo#1 is on the following and I am mostly interested in feedback on those areas, but other suggestions are certainly welcome:
1) crashes/fail to loads/game doesn't runs
2) combat system
3) player controls and UI
Enlit3D
2017-10-12 04:51:04 +0000 UTCDrew
2017-10-12 04:15:25 +0000 UTCMoonshield
2017-10-06 21:18:27 +0000 UTCFrank Baum
2017-10-06 11:50:14 +0000 UTCRay Animus
2017-10-06 08:38:40 +0000 UTCBunnyUqou
2017-10-06 05:49:03 +0000 UTC